2016-10-31 5 views
0

Недавно я использовал RestAssured для тестирования Rest API и, похоже, это очень полезно. Однако у меня есть запрос относительно тестирования конечных точек отдыха. Мы не размещаем наши службы локально на сервере. Мы пишем тесты тестирования и интеграции модулей и тестируем их и развертываем в отдельной среде dev1. Я хочу написать интеграционный тест, который отправит запрос и проверит конечную точку останова, используя restassured.Kindly советую. Благодарю.Запросы относительно RestAssured

P.S. У нас нет локального сервера, где мы можем развертывать и удалять конечную точку останова.

+0

Может быть связано: HTTP: // StackOverflow. com/questions/36283606/restassured-testing-without-running-tomcat – Justas

ответ

-1

Вы можете установить URL удаленного сервера глобально для всех тестов с помощью RestAssured.baseURI="<BaseURL>" или вы можете пройти полный URL в самом методе RestAssured как get("http://baseURL/service1")

+0

Лучше объявлять URL-адреса для тестовых тестов внутри тестовых классов в строковой переменной и использовать их в случае разных методов HTTP (get/post/ставить/удалять). –